Transaction 180ae0d1e3f36efb79a8a13b4f7a23b56ccf17baa46bf6c28ac8fbb12e62afc8
1 Input
2 Outputs
- 180ae0d1e3f36efb79a8a13b4f7a23b56ccf17baa46bf6c28ac8fbb12e62afc8:0
- 180ae0d1e3f36efb79a8a13b4f7a23b56ccf17baa46bf6c28ac8fbb12e62afc8:1
value 20900000
address 1B2FZKJW8doZ32dssnTHwmikJPVHmR1xFH
value 357106647
address 15vAtjxseiyTFT6Q3hixxLXj9N8f3vQL4u